Importance Of Fire And Safety Equipment In Ensuring Workplace Safety

In any workplace or establishment, the safety and well-being of employees should be of utmost priority. One of the key elements in ensuring this is the presence of adequate fire and safety equipment. These tools are essential in preventing accidents, mitigating risks, and responding effectively in the event of an emergency.

fire and safety equipment encompass a wide range of tools and devices that are designed to protect individuals and property from the dangers of fires, accidents, and other hazards. The most common types of fire and safety equipment include fire extinguishers, fire alarms, smoke detectors, first aid kits, emergency lighting, and personal protective equipment (PPE).

Fire extinguishers are perhaps the most recognizable and crucial piece of fire safety equipment. They come in various types and sizes, each designed to combat specific types of fires. It is essential for workplaces to have the right type of fire extinguishers readily available and properly maintained to ensure they are functional when needed.

Fire alarms and smoke detectors are another critical component of fire safety equipment. These devices are designed to alert individuals of a potential fire hazard, allowing them to evacuate the premises promptly and safely. Regular maintenance and testing of fire alarms and smoke detectors are vital to ensure they are in proper working condition.

First aid kits are essential in providing immediate medical assistance in the event of an injury or emergency. These kits contain essential supplies such as bandages, gauze, antiseptic wipes, and other items needed to treat minor injuries. Having a well-stocked first aid kit readily available can make a significant difference in the outcome of an emergency situation.

Emergency lighting is crucial in ensuring that individuals can safely evacuate a building in the event of a power outage or emergency situation. These lights are designed to provide illumination in dark or smoke-filled areas, guiding individuals to safety. Regular testing and maintenance of emergency lighting systems are necessary to ensure they function properly when needed.

Personal protective equipment (PPE) is essential in preventing injuries and illnesses in the workplace. This equipment includes items such as safety goggles, gloves, hard hats, and high-visibility clothing, among others. Employers should provide appropriate PPE to employees based on the specific hazards present in their workplace.

In addition to having the right fire and safety equipment in place, it is crucial for employers to establish and communicate clear safety protocols and procedures to employees. Regular training and drills should be conducted to ensure that individuals are prepared to respond effectively in the event of an emergency.
